England
fans cheered on captain Harry Kane, who scored twice in the team's 2026 World
Cup debut. They beat Croatia
4
to2 in Arlington, Texas. Kane is now tied for the most World Cup goals of all
time by an England player with 10. In
Houston,
the Democratic Republic of Congo scored the equalizer in stoppage time against
Portugal. Uh this was the
Congo's
first World Cup appearance since 1974.
And
in Toronto, Ghana have noticed not rather their first win in the tournament.
Another stoppage time goal
made
uh the difference in this match versus Panama. Ghana 1 nil. And finally,
Usbekistan scored once its uh World
Cup
debut in Mexico City, but they were no match for Colombia and Daniel Munoz with
a goal late in the first. Colombia
added
two more to win three to one. with me now from Dallas, Henry Winter, football
writer and columnist for World
Soccer.

let's talk about what's up next for England. Ghana. Ghana um beat Panama today.
Nothing
for most of that match. And then in minute 95 uh a score. How does that matchup
look uh for Tuesday, England and Ghana?
Well,
I think England against Croatia was always going to be the biggest test in
terms of the sort of the highest ranked team that they were going to face. Uh
Croatia and England have a
little
bit of history. Croatia knocked England out of the World Cup of 2018 in in
Moscow. And you know, they're
a
good team, but you know, everyone was saying, well, this was such an important
result that England got, but you have to remember that it was played indoors,
as
you
say, in Arlington. And I think the temperature and the air condition stadium
was only about 23. Now you know what we're like in England. We're
obsessed
with the weather. If it goes above 23 24 that's a heat wave. So, I think the
problem that England have had will have when they play against a team
like
Ghana if it's really hot that will be an issue for England.
You
know that's interesting. I don't uh think that we've actually had that
conversation. the um climate influence
on
some of these matches obviously coming from different parts of the world and
the sensitivities to some of these players in their typical uh environment.
Well,
you know what the English are like. We love talking about the weather and I
mean it is huge and the weather extremes that uh that's been seen here. I mean
England got hit by a
tornado
uh the other night in Kansas City. So, uh you know there's all those dramas but
this game indoors was really
important
that England had that because Croatia who keep the ball very well when they've
got players like Luca Modric and Kovichic who came off the bench that can
test
England. England don't do great in in hot conditions and they want to play a
very competitive Premier League style
English
style up and atom game under this German coach and that is risky in hot
weather. So, it's going to be interesting to see how they play against
Ghana
and then Panama. But, look, they've got these three points under the belt.
They're all but qualified for the next round, but they want to finish top.
We
haven't spoken since the uh Portugal Democratic Republic of Congo uh ended in a
draw obviously. And Cristiano Ronaldo
um
a lot of disappointment in his performance, pretty flat. What happened there?
Well,
probably not a lot of surprise because he is what 40 41 been an absolutely
magnificent footballer. I
think
five balandors. You look at the performance that he has had. There's basically
been three iterations of Cristiano Ronaldo, the flyer out wide,
the
centre forward, and the slightly more measured sort of stealth player.
But,
you know, the one opponent even the greats can't beat is old father time.
And
I think they have a big call to make with Portugal now whether they drop this
talismanic figure who has a lot of
influence
on the country and on the team on the dressing room. That's a big call but I
think it's a call that has to be made.

so much. So, the goalkeeper known as Vzinia, who starred in Cape Verde's
incredible World Cup draw with Spain,
may
have a special visitor for his next match in Miami, and that's his mother.
House
Minority Leader Hakee Jeff says that she will get a visa in time for the match
against Uruguay on Sunday. Now,
she
says the fees, or he says, I should say, the fees have been waved. Now, Vzena
told reporters that his mother was not able to watch his match in person on
Monday
because she could not afford the bond for a visa, but she was watching back at
home.
It
was very emotional for me. My heart was almost jumping out of my chest. I was
nervous but very happy for everything he has achieved in this tournament.
His
grandfather would often say, "Let's go to the football field." and
would take him there. His father didn't like him playing football. His
grandfather
would
tell him, "One day I will see you at the World Cup." And that's
exactly what happened.
There
is just a whirlwind of support around Voinia. He made seven saves against
Spain. And look at this. His
Instagram
account jumped from about 50,000 followers now to more than 12 and a half
million.
